The most epic sky...

Neither words nor photographs can capture what I witnessed as the sun set over one of the most incredible lakes in the entire western United States. 

WAY off the beaten track, Dora Lake sits high on a bench in the often-forgotten Gore Range in Colorado. There are no trails to it, nor are there any easy ways to get there. It’s a steep, 4,000-foot ascent through some unforgiving terrain. I got the priviledge of attempting it through a massive hail storm (complete with powerful thunder and lighting) and pounding rain as I traveresed a mostly-exposed route.

Not an adventure for the faint of heart (as I look back at it)

At times I wanted to give up and head back down, but I am so thankful I pushed through. Because once I got there, I was blown away by the beautiful isolation of Dora Lake. And then at sunset, the storm-laiden sky was utterly magnificent. I’ve never seen such clouds at such a unique location. The billows, lit on fire, literally reached up into the heavens.

Definitely the most epic sky I’ve ever witnessed in all of my backpacking adventures. And that’s saying a lot!
